Output 6f0c44066ccae9fe2ed6a2bf7bf1164959d7169680823653ab84a0fc80cb50b1:2

value
550381526
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d0dad7045230576e888cfa689950215dc3fcc59 OP_EQUAL
address
3MqqeGTGK6csibsF4xpfyajXvpF8PojuM3
transaction
6f0c44066ccae9fe2ed6a2bf7bf1164959d7169680823653ab84a0fc80cb50b1
confirmations
356842
spent
true